What is Zylet (Loteprednol Etabonate)?

Loteprednol Etabonate Ophthalmic Gel is a corticosteroid indicated for the treatment of post-operative inflammation and pain following ocular surgery. The Role of Loteprednol in Reducing Post-Intravitreal Injection Related Pain

Summary: Patients are already receiving an intravitreal injection as a standard of care, but they are consenting to receiving a loteprednol drop following the intravitreal injection. This clinical trial is studying the role of loteprednol (corticosteroid) in reducing pain following intravitreal injections for patients with age-related macular degeneration.
